Uasin Gishu County Commissioner Abdi Hassan has warned striking teachers against invading private schools that are currently on with learning.
Speaking in his office on Thursday, Abdi said that he has received credible information that teachers’ officials, during their prayer meeting on Thursday at TAC centre in Eldoret, planned to raid private schools starting Monday, and warned them against such acts.
“Teachers should conduct their strike peacefully, any misbehavior will not be tolerated. I urge Teachers’ officials to stop inciting teachers against private schools since their employers are not the same and such act will be treated as criminal and you will be arrested and prosecuted on the same,” he said
On Thursday, during a prayer session that brought together teachers including KUPPET Uasin Gishu Branch Secretary General Rosemary Mrundu, Chepkoilel KNUT Branch Secretary General Sammy Bor and Wareng KNUT Branch Secretary General John Bor vowed to invade all private primary and secondary schools that are continuing with studies and force them to join in the strike.
“From Monday, if TSC could have not effected the 50-60 percent pay increase, we will paralyze learning in all private schools since we cannot be on the ground fighting for the rights of teachers while others are teaching and yet at one time they will be employed by TSC, we won’t allow such,” they said.
